Career Academies

A career academy is a career-themed small learning community with an emphasis on application of academic coursework to a broad career field and work experience through partnerships with community employers.  Career academies differ from traditional academic and vocational education because they prepare high school students for both college and careers.  Academies provide broad information about a field such as health care, finance, engineering, or natural resources.

Washington County Public Schools offers the following Academy Programs:

 Academy of Biomedical Sciences at Washington County Technical High School
           
 Academy of Finance at Williamsport High School
      
 Academy of Teaching Professions at North Hagerstown High School and South Hagerstown High School  

 Environmental Agricultural Science Academy at Clear Spring High School 
    
 Fire & Rescue Academy at Washington County Technical High School
 
 ORACLE Academy at South Hagerstown High School
 
 Pre-Civil Engineering and Architecture Academy/Pre-Engineering Program at Washington County Technical High School

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ics (STEM) Academy at Williamsport High School


Career Academies are open to students from all WCPS high schools, and applications are required for admission.  Students and parents interested in more information should contact Cody Pine, Supervisor of Career Technology Education Program, at 301-766-2956.
